Why fabric beats vinyl on a step-and-repeat

Vinyl is cheaper, but it glares under flash and reads cheap in photos. Fabric SEG (silicone edge graphics) absorbs light, ships folded without creases, and looks premium in every shot. For anything posted to social, fabric is the only answer.

Logo grid that actually photographs well

Most step-and-repeats fail in photos because the logo is too small, the grid is too sparse, or the guest's head covers the only legible logo. Our default grid sizes the logo to ~50% of guest height with enough density that every cropped photo includes at least two visible logos. We test against framing before we proof.

Designing a step-and-repeat that photographs correctly+
Two rules decide everything: logo scale and tile density. Logos should be about half the height of a standing guest’s head-to-shoulder area, and staggered on a 20-30 degree offset so no cropped phone photo can miss them. Keep the background one flat brand color - gradients band under flash. Leave 6 inches of dead space at the bottom for the floor line, and never place a logo where two guests will stand.
Fabric vs. vinyl for press walls+
Tension fabric is the right call for almost every Vegas event: matte finish that kills flash glare, no wrinkles after transport, washable, and it packs into a case that fits a car trunk. Vinyl is cheaper up front but glares under photographer strobes and creases permanently at fold lines. Use vinyl only for outdoor mesh runs where wind load matters.
Venue logistics and mounting choices+
Indoor ballrooms at Wynn, Bellagio, and Cosmopolitan usually have pipe rigging, so a pipe-and-drape kit is fastest. Pool decks, outdoor activations, and convention floors need a free-standing aluminum frame with weighted feet. Anything hung from a convention-center ceiling requires a rigging order through the venue - we file it with your show paperwork if needed.

What size should our step-and-repeat be?+

8x8 fits two to three people per photo and covers most sponsor and party walls. 10x8 is the pick for group shots, media lines, and award photos. Red-carpet arrivals with a photographer pit usually run 16-20 ft wide so the crop always lands inside the branding.
